This film offers a visual record of a mid-twentieth century major grassroots conservation effort that had regional environmental significance in convincing state and national governments to abandon a longstanding U.S. Army Corps of Engineers dam project on the Buffalo River in northern Arkansas. It is one of 13 films created in the early 1960s by Dr. Neil Compton, Bentonville, Arkansas, the founding president of the Ozark Society, to promote keeping the Buffalo River free-flowing and undammed. In 1972 the Buffalo National River was designated as the United States' first national river.
